Beginnings of Martial Arts
Martial arts originated in various regions around the world, developing as practical combat systems to resist risks. These ancient combating styles were developed out of necessity, with each society crafting methods suited to their unique atmospheres and obstacles. From the grappling arts of Jujutsu in Japan to the striking methods of Kung Fu in China, martial arts were deeply linked with the historical, social, and cultural material of their corresponding cultures.
In Japan, the samurai class refined martial arts like Kenjutsu, the art of the sword, which later evolved into the much more promoted kind of Kendo. Meanwhile, in Brazil, Capoeira became a mix of dance and fight, created by enslaved Africans as a means to stand up to injustice. Each martial art brings with it an abundant history and viewpoint, mirroring the worths and ideas of the people who practiced them.

Development of Methods
Through centuries of method and refinement, fight methods within various martial arts have undergone a profound development. From ancient designs like Martial art and Martial arts to more contemporary disciplines such as Brazilian Jiu-Jitsu and Krav Maga, the advancement of techniques has actually been driven by a mix of cultural impacts, functional applications, and technical developments.
One substantial element of this advancement is the cross-pollination of strategies between different martial arts. For example, methods from standard Japanese Jiu-Jitsu were integrated right into the creation of Judo by Jigoro Kano in the late 19th century. This mixing of designs has led to the development of hybrid martial arts like Mixed Martial Arts (MMA), which combine elements of striking, grappling, and entry methods.
Additionally, the development of strategies has been shaped by the raising focus on effectiveness and effectiveness in fight. Experts have continuously looked for to refine their techniques through strenuous training, testing, and competitors, causing the advancement of extremely specialized and efficient battling designs. Generally, the evolution of strategies in martial arts shows the dynamic nature of combat and the ongoing mission for enhancement and technology.
Philosophical Structures
Exploring the underlying thoughtful concepts of martial arts offers insight right into their core values and directing ideas. At the heart of numerous martial arts techniques is the concept of discipline itself. By educating your mind and body to act as one natural unit, you cultivate self-control that extends past the dojo or fitness center right into everyday life. This technique encompasses respect, humility, and self-control, forming not simply your physical abilities but also your character.
Another basic philosophical foundation in martial arts is the idea of continual self-improvement. The trip of understanding a fighting style is perpetual, with professionals frequently aiming to better themselves, both physically and mentally. This focus on growth cultivates resilience, willpower, and a development attitude that can be put on all aspects of life.
Additionally, martial arts highlight the importance of consistency and equilibrium. Methods are made to use an opponent's power against them, highlighting the principle of yielding and rerouting pressure rather than meeting it head-on. This viewpoint encompasses interpersonal partnerships, promoting relaxed resolutions and good understanding. By welcoming these philosophical foundations, martial musicians not only improve their combat skills yet additionally grow a way of life fixated personal growth, respect, and consistency.
